认证服务器是指什么
-
认证服务器是指一种网络服务器,用于验证用户的身份和权限。它是一种安全机制,用于确保只有经过身份验证的用户可以访问特定的资源或服务。
认证服务器的主要功能是验证用户提供的凭证(通常是用户名和密码),并将其与存储在服务器上的用户数据库中的信息进行比对。如果凭证有效且匹配,则认证服务器会向用户颁发一个令牌,该令牌可以用作后续请求的身份验证凭证。
在身份验证过程中,认证服务器会采用各种安全协议和技术,如HTTPS、加密算法等,以确保用户的凭证在传输过程中不被恶意篡改或窃取。此外,认证服务器还可以实施其他安全措施,如密码策略、多因素身份验证等,以增强系统的安全性。
认证服务器广泛应用于各种网络服务和应用场景中,例如企业内部的单点登录系统、云服务中心、电子商务网站等。通过集中管理和验证用户的身份和权限,认证服务器可以帮助组织提高系统安全性、防止未授权访问,并简化用户的登录流程。
总之,认证服务器是一种用于验证用户身份和权限的网络服务器,它通过验证用户提供的凭证,并颁发令牌来实现身份验证。它是构建安全可靠的网络服务和应用的重要组成部分。
1年前 -
认证服务器是指一个用于验证和授权用户身份的服务器。它扮演着身份提供者和身份验证服务的角色,用于验证用户的身份是否合法,并根据用户的身份和权限向用户提供相应的资源和服务。以下是关于认证服务器的一些重要信息:
-
用户身份验证:认证服务器用于验证用户的身份。当用户尝试登录系统时,他们需要提供自己的身份凭证,例如用户名和密码。认证服务器会验证这些凭证的正确性,并确认用户的身份。
-
访问控制和权限管理:认证服务器还用于控制用户对资源和服务的访问权限。用户在成功验证身份后,认证服务器会根据其身份和权限级别,决定用户可以访问哪些资源或执行哪些操作。
-
单点登录(Single Sign-On,简称SSO):认证服务器还支持单点登录功能。单点登录是一种身份验证机制,允许用户使用一组凭证(例如用户名和密码)登录多个相关应用或网站,而不需要为每个应用或网站独立进行身份验证。
-
Token-based 认证:认证服务器通常使用令牌(token)进行身份验证。当用户成功登录后,认证服务器会颁发令牌给用户,该令牌包含了用户的身份信息和访问权限。用户之后在与其他系统交互时,只需使用令牌作为身份凭证,而无需再次提供用户名和密码。
-
与其他服务的集成:认证服务器通常与其他服务集成,如用户数据库、LDAP(轻量级目录访问协议)服务器、OAuth 服务器等。这些集成可以使认证服务器获取用户的信息并进行身份验证。
总之,认证服务器是用于验证和授权用户身份的服务器,在用户登录系统时确保用户的身份安全,并根据用户的身份和权限提供相应的资源和服务。它提供了访问控制、单点登录和使用令牌进行身份验证等功能。
1年前 -
-
认证服务器(Authentication Server)是一种网络服务器,用于验证用户身份和提供访问控制服务。它是网络身份验证和授权的关键组成部分,用于确保只有授权用户才能访问受保护的系统和资源。
认证服务器的主要功能是验证用户提供的身份凭证,并根据身份凭证授予或拒绝用户的访问权限。身份凭证可以是用户名和密码、数字证书、令牌等。认证服务器会通过验证用户提供的身份凭证来确认用户的身份,并根据其身份和访问权限来控制用户的访问权限。
认证服务器的工作流程通常包括以下几个步骤:
- 用户发送身份凭证:用户向认证服务器发送其身份凭证,例如用户名和密码。
- 身份验证:认证服务器接收到用户的身份凭证后,会对其进行身份验证。这可以包括验证用户名和密码的正确性,检查数字证书的有效性,或根据令牌的签名来验证令牌的真实性。
- 授权过程:一旦用户被成功验证,认证服务器将根据用户的身份和访问权限来决定用户被允许访问的资源。这可能涉及到访问控制列表(ACL)或角色继承等机制。
- 访问控制:在用户被授予访问权限后,认证服务器将生成一个临时的访问令牌或会话令牌,并将其返回给用户。用户可以使用该令牌来访问受保护的资源。
- 令牌管理:认证服务器通常还负责管理令牌的生命周期。这包括颁发令牌、刷新令牌、吊销令牌等操作,以确保令牌的合法性和安全性。
认证服务器可以作为独立的服务器,也可以集成在其他系统或服务中。它可以与其他身份验证和授权机制结合使用,如单点登录(SSO)、多因素身份验证(MFA)等,以提供更强大的身份验证和访问控制功能。
1年前